ST. CLOUD - St. Cloud police have arrested four teenagers for allegedly robbing a cab driver at gunpoint.

Nineteen-year-old Treyvon Dudley of Zimmerman, a 14-year-old girl from Sartell, a 17-year-old boy from St. Cloud and a 15-year-old boy from St. Cloud were arrested after an investigation early this (Wednesday) morning.

The incident began when the cabbie was called to the 2100 block of 8th Street North.  After picking-up two of the suspects, they pointed a gun at the driver and demanded money.  They then took off on foot.

The investigation led officers to an address in Sartell. Dudley is being held in the Stearns County Jail, while the three minors were taken to Juvenile Facility.

The 56-year-old cab driver was not hurt.

Sauk Rapids' and Waite Park's Police K9 units assisted with the call.  The Criminal Investigation Unit is continuing with the investigation.
